Abstract
The utility model discloses a kind of U-shaped LED of high-cooling property, including lamp holder, upper cover, power supply, middle cover, mainboard, lower cover, radiator, lateral side lamp board component, top lamp plate assembly, it is characterized in that: described power supply is located between upper cover and middle cover, it is provided with fan between this power supply and middle cover, described top lamp plate assembly outer side covers top PC cover, described fan and the heat dissipation channel of radiator, the through hole of mainboard, the louvre of middle cover, the air grid of lower cover, the thermal vias of top lamp plate assembly and top PC cover forms open ventilation and heat structure, this utility model is separated and radiator modular design structure by power supply, heat dispersion is made greatly to be promoted, meet the cooling requirements of high-powered LED lamp, and energy-conserving and environment-protective, low cost.

This utility model uses power supply and radiator separation design, power supply and radiator is separated by fan fixed plate,
And be additionally provided with installing plate bottom power supply, further function as the effect of isolation, in through hole in the middle of the louvre that covers and mainboard,
All form heat extraction passage, beneficially fan heat extraction;This utility model uses radiator modularity isolating construction, light source board further
Plug-in unit intermediate formation heat dissipation channel, good heat dissipation effect;Two-stage radiation structure adds air grid and the top lamp plate assembly of upper and lower covers
And the thermal vias in the middle of top PC cover, heat radiation return flow line is integrally formed, reaches more preferable radiating effect.
